Product Description
- Behringer Model D
- Analogue Desktop Synthesiser in Classic Design
- Analogue signal path (VCO mixer-VCF-VCA)
- 3 VCOs with 5 waveforms
- 24 dB ladder filter with resonance
- High pass / low pass modes
- Analogue LFO with rectangle / triangle waveforms
- Monophonic sound generation with polychain option for up to 16 voices
- Noise generator
- Overdrive circuit
- Semi-modular with 13 patch points
- 49 Control elements for direct access
- Can be used as a full Eurorack synthesiser voice (width: 70 HP)
- 3.5 mm Audio input for sound processing from external sources
- 2 Line outputs (6.3 mm) with different levels
- 3.5 mm headphone output
- MIDI In / Thru and USB-MIDI
- Dimensions: 90 x 374 x 136 mm
- Weight: 1.7 kg
- Power adapter included (12 V DC
- 1000 mA)
